Web服务和Windows服务之间有什么区别?

Rya*_*ott 18 web-services windows-services

Web服务和Windows服务之间有什么区别?

我的经验主要是Windows服务,我从未创建过Web服务.

Web服务的行为与Windows服务类似吗?
他们可以安排,在某些时间运行等吗?
当您使用Web服务代替Windows服务时,反之亦然?

Wel*_*bog 43

它们与两件事情有所不同.

Windows服务是在用户没有登录系统的情况下运行的应用程序,通常用于处理机器上的一些数据,无需用户干预即可使用.

Web服务是一个网站,在联系时,返回XML(通常)为几种标准格式之一,供服务使用者处理.

一个人不能替代另一个人.它们根本不同.

  • +1,JSON是响应格式的流行第二选项 (8认同)

GEO*_*HET 12

你要我们比较苹果和橘子.我正在发布定义以及为您进一步阅读的链接,因此您可以看到为什么这两个东西是独占的,无法像您尝试那样进行比较.

网络服务:

Web服务通常只是Internet应用程序编程接口(API),可以通过网络(如Internet)访问,并在托管所请求服务的远程系统上执行

Windows服务:

Windows服务是一种长期运行的可执行文件,它执行特定的功能,其设计不需要用户干预.